Introduction to Ford Powershift Transmission Control Unit
The Powershift Transmission Control Unit (TCU) is a critical component in Ford's dual-clutch transmission systems. Its primary role is to manage the operation of the transmission by controlling gear shifts and ensuring optimal performance. However, like any electronic system, it is susceptible to failures that can lead to a range of issues. Understanding the symptoms and fault codes associated with TCU failure can aid in prompt diagnosis and repair.
Symptoms of TCU Failure in Ford Vehicles
When the Powershift TCU begins to fail, drivers may experience various symptoms that can arise suddenly or develop over time. Some common indicators include:
- Unusual or harsh shifting during acceleration and deceleration
- Frequent slipping of gears or unexpected loss of power
- Delayed or failed engagement when shifting from Park to Drive
- Vehicle stuttering or jerking during gear changes
- Illumination of the check engine or transmission warning lights on the dashboard

Common Fault Codes Associated with TCU Issues
When diagnosing a potential Powershift TCU failure, mechanics often use an onboard diagnostic tool to retrieve fault codes. These codes provide valuable insights into the malfunctioning components of the transmission system. Some of the common fault codes related to TCU failure include:
- P0715: Input/Turbine Speed Sensor A Range/Performance Problem
- P0720: Output Speed Sensor Circuit Malfunction
- P0700: Transmission Control System Malfunction
- P0868: Transmission Fluid Pressure Low
These codes point to specific issues that may arise due to a faulty TCU, and addressing them can help restore normal operation.
Repair Options for TCU Failure
When faced with a Powershift TCU failure, vehicle owners have several repair options to consider. Depending on the severity of the issue, these options may include:
- Reprogramming the TCU: Sometimes, the TCU may just need to be recalibrated or reprogrammed to fix software-related issues.
- Repairs or replacement of sensors: If fault codes indicate that specific sensors are malfunctioning, replacing these parts may resolve the issues without needing a full TCU replacement.
- Complete TCU replacement: In cases of severe damage or failure, replacing the entire TCU may be the most effective solution. This process typically requires professional assistance to ensure proper installation.
